The Estadio Monumental Isidro Romero Carbo (Estadio Monumental de Barcelona before its renaming in 1997) is a football stadium located in the parish of Tarqui in the north of Guayaquil, Ecuador. It was inaugurated on December 27, 1987, and is the new home to the Ecuadorian football clubs Barcelona Sporting Club and Club Atlético Guayaquil (a lower-division team that belongs to Barcelona Sporting Club). Barcelona's first game was against Peñarol. The Estadio Monumental replaced the Estadio Modelo Alberto Spencer. The Estadio Monumental Isidro Romero Carbo has a capacity of 89,932 spectators, four health care facilities, apparel-and-souvenir shops, and restaurants, on a total area of about 5,100 square meters. The football field is 105 meters long and 70 meters wide.
